Mission Statement

Our mission is to make available a variety of mental health and counseling services for the benefit of individuals and families in need, for whom access or utilization of such services are generally limited, restricted or otherwise unavailable.

Description

Straight Talk Clinic is a 501(c)3 nonprofit organization founded in 1971 to serve families and individuals seeking low or no-cost counseling services and mental health treatment, and/or related services. Our organization have launched numerous programs and developed a variety of specialized services for the disadvantaged populations with limited resources. We have been a pioneer to promote and provide accessible, affordable and effective prevention and intervention services for children and families across Orange County. Straight Talk Clinic’s sliding-fee scale, evening and weekend hours counseling programs address the special needs of low-income groups including children, adolescents, parents, couples, and seniors.
